Latest Patents

Tianhang Zhang holds a patent for an "Experiment platform for simulating fire in underground traffic conversion channel." This invention includes a model body designed to simulate fire scenarios, a burner for generating smoke, and a sophisticated smoke imaging system. The imaging system utilizes laser sheet light sources and image recording devices to capture smoke distribution images effectively. This technology is crucial for understanding fire behavior in confined spaces and improving safety protocols.
